Address

ecash:qzczd8p9pn5ka2pg72yy239zxt6tljwzxv53nuyx24Copy

Total Received

150505.47 XEC

Total Sent

150505.47 XEC

№ Transactions

10

Final Balance

0 XEC

Transactions
Filter